1. color coded

I hear colors speak
blue says I need therapy
red says start a fire

2. where gravity forgot me

mood swings on ceilin
laughin where gravity quits
I clap in defeat

3. fetch boy

shadows bark my name
I toss one a broken thought
it brings back a grin

4. rogue epiphany

clarity short out
thoughts glitch like gods on crack
I praise the misfire

5. what’s the bleedin time

time drips off the clock
hours crawl tired broken beasts
I step over noon

6. the mirror wouldn’t take my face so it gave me someone I almost recognized

mirror won’t commit
gives me back one version twice
both of us look tired

7. swore under oath

rationality
face down hands cuffed to my tongue
heart screams alibi
